Information about the school

St John’s is a four-form entry primary academy located in Gravesend, serving the Parish of St John the Evangelist and the local area. It is part of the Kent Catholic Schools Partnership (KCSP), a multi-academy trust established by the Archdiocese of Southwark for Catholic education across Kent which currently comprises of 26 academies (21 primary and 5 secondary).

St John’s is an inclusive academy. Its dedicated staff, helpers and governance committee members work hard to ensure that every student is supported and challenged to be their very best. Each individual is encouraged to grow spiritually and intellectually, so that unique and positive contributions can be made to society and the world. Our most recent denominational inspection in November 2022 and Ofsted inspection in November 2023 judged the academy to be ‘Good’.
